Gladys Nederlander Dies

Theatre and television producer Gladys Nederlander, 83, died of heart failure July 21 in New York City, according to her husband, Robert Nederlander.

She started her career in radio and went on to produce nine Broadway shows between 1976 and 1983, most notably the Tony Award-winning, 1980 revival of "West Side Story" starring Debbie Allen.

In 1982 Nederlander was named executive producer for Nederlander Television and Film Productions, which turned out TV movies including "A Case of Libel" with Ed Asner and Daniel J. Travanti, and "Intimate Strangers" with Stacey Keach.
